Abstract

Snake venoms enzymes affect diverse physiological mechanisms leading to effects such as inflammation, edema, hemolysis, and blood clotting disorders. In this report, we describe modifications to classical assays for assessing the enzymatic activity of snake venom phospholipase A2 (PLA2) and phosphodiesterase (PDE), including the adaptation of the PDE assay to an agar plate. A final staining step, using Stains-all (R), was added to the PLA2 activity assay on an egg yolk-containing agar plate. Moreover, PDE activity was successfully and qualitative assed using an agar plate-immobilized bis- p-nitrophenyl-phosphate. The modified methods introduced in this study improve accessibility for a broader spectrum of researchers, enabling venom-related investigations in any laboratory setting, with special relevance for regions where snakebites are most prevalent.
